About this experience
Welcome to Manchester City's home stadium!
Embark on a Manchester City Stadium tour and immerse yourself in the club's legacy. Explore areas of the stadium typically closed to the public.
The Manchester City Stadium is abbreviated as COMS, also known as the Eastlands or City of Manchester Stadium. It was later renamed Etihad Stadium after receiving sponsorship from Etihad Airways. It is the fourth-largest football stadium in England and the tenth-largest sports venue in the UK. Football is one of Manchester's defining themes and a key part of its culture. In addition to the "Red Devils" Manchester United, there is also the "Blue Moon" Manchester City, with Etihad Stadium serving as Manchester City's new home ground.
